If your Joy-Con controller/s are still not charging at this time, the next good thing that you can do is to disconnect the charging cable from the charging ...The Nintendo Switch has 2 main failure points for charging-related issues, M92T36 and P13USB. M92T36 is a custom USB-C power management IC created by Rohm Semiconductor specifically for Nintendo Switch products. ... A power issue is the main cause of a blinking green light on a Switch Dock. Restarting the console should fix it unless it’s a hardware problem requiring a replacement of the AC adapter. If the issue continues, the dock may need to be replaced, and you should contact Nintendo Switch support. When the green light …Jan 12, 2022 · Unplug the AC adapter from the wall. Wait one minute with the adapter unplugged. Plug the AC adapter back in. Connect the Switch to the charging cable. Wait 30 minutes and check to see whether the charging indicator is displayed. If you can see the charging indicator after 30 minutes, let the Switch charge fully. 14 Oct 2022 ... Here are some common reasons why a Switch may not charge, or the charge may not last long: There is a problem with the outlet you plug the charger into. The USB-C charging port or AC adapter may need to be cleaned. Using the incorrect charging cable to attempt to power the Nintendo Switch console. The charging dock itself may have experienced ... The Pro Controller can be charged in the following ways: While connected to the Nintendo Switch dock. Connect the Nintendo Switch AC adapter to the dock and then to a wall outlet. Note: In order to charge the Pro Controller, the Nintendo Switch console does not need to be docked.
